NOBIS TO DONATE 100% OF ONLINE SALES TO HELP FIGHT COVID-19

by Stephen Garner

Nobis has announced a three-week global initiative where 100 percent of all online sales will be donated to protect frontline health care professionals who continue to spearhead the fight against COVID-19. 

From now through April 30th, the pre-tax purchase price from all online sales on Nobis.com will go directly to support hospitals and healthcare workers around the world responding to COVID-19 in urgent need of supplies and Personal Protective Equipment (PPE).

Customers making any purchase on Nobis.com by April 30th will be able to direct the donation funds to the organization of their choice, by selecting the hospital or organization name at the time of check out.

In Canada, the list of recipients include the CanadaHelps COVID-19 Healthcare & Hospital Fund, which supports over 90 hospital foundations across Canada, and five local Ontario hospitals – Headwaters Health Care Centre, Markham Stouffville Hospital, Scarborough General Hospital, Toronto General Hospital and William Osler Health System. All international sales will be directed to the Red Cross COVID-19 Global Appeal to enable Red Cross and Red Crescents around the world to support COVID-19 preparedness, response and recovery activities.

This program is being implemented in addition to the commitment made last week when the brand donated $100,000 to local hospitals in Ontario.

“Nobis, which is Latin for ‘us,’ has always understood the importance of community, and we are incredibly proud of and indebted to our frontline healthcare providers whose bravery and selflessness are a beacon of hope in uncertain times,” said Robin Yates, co-founder and vice president of Nobis. “There has never been a more crucial time for us to further our community support. This is why Nobis is doing everything within our means to recognize and support the incredible sacrifice being made by these outstanding individuals in the ongoing battle against COVID-19.”
